举一反三
- 建立查询学号为“9512101”的学生选修的课程和成绩的视图,要求列出学号、课程名和成绩,使用语句
- 在student、course和sc表的基础上,查询学分大于“数据库基础”课程学分的课程名和开课学期,使用语句
- 在student、course和sc表的基础上,统计选修了“数据库基础”课程的学生的平均成绩,使用语句
- 在“查询选修课程号为C04,且成绩在80分以上的所有学生的学号和姓名”的SQL语句中,将使用的表有 A: 仅STUDENT B: 仅STUDENT和COURSE C: 仅STUDENT和SC D: STUDENT、COURSE和SC
- 使用教务管理系统中的学生表(student),选课表(sc)和课程(course),用SQL语句实现下列1—6小题: 1. 检索所有选修了课程号为“16020010”的课程的学生的学号和分数;
内容
- 0
在一个教学管理数据库应用系统中,有学生情况表S、课程开设表C和学生选课成绩表SC,其中SNO、CNO分别是学生学号和课程号。执行下列SQL查询语句: 其查询结果为()。 A: 选修课程号为’D101’的学生学号 B: 选修课程号为’D101’的学生姓名 C: S表中学号与SC表中学号相等的元组信息 D: 选修课程号为‘D101’或S表和SC表中具有相同SNO的元组信息
- 1
对于教学数据库的三个基本表: S(学号,姓名 ,年龄,性别) SC(学号 ,课程号,成绩) C(课程号 ,课程名,任课教师姓名) 试用SQL语句表达下列查询: ⑴ 查询姓刘的老师所授课程的课程号和课程名。 ⑵ 查询年龄大于23岁的男同学的学号和姓名。 ⑶ 查询学号为S3的学生所学课程的课程号、课程名和任课教师姓名。 ⑷ 查询“张小飞”没有选修的课程号和课程名。 ⑸ 查询至少选修了3门课程的学生的学号和姓名。
- 2
基于课本52页图2.4中的student、course、sc表,使用SQL查询语句完成下列各题: (1)查询学生的学号及其平均成绩。 (2)查询各个课程号及其平均成绩。 (3)查询平均成绩大于等于86分的学生学号和平均成绩。 (4)查询有两个或两个以上学生选修的课程的课程号和选课人数。
- 3
有学生、选修和课程三个关系,学生S(学号,姓名,性别….),课程C(课程号,课程名),选修SC(学号,课程号,成绩)。想查询选修2号课程的学生的学号和姓名,则关系运算式应写成
- 4
【单选题】有学生、选修和课程三个关系,学生S(学号,姓名,性别),课程C(课程号,课程名),选修SC(学号,课程号,成绩)。想查询选修2号课程的学生的学号和姓名,则关系运算式应写成( )。 A: ∏学号(δ课程号=2 (S∞SC)) B: ∏学号,姓名(δ课程号=2 (S)) C: ∏学号,姓名(δ课程号=2 (S∞SC)) D: δ课程号=2 (∏学号,姓名(S∞SC))